Output 50eea889c32aa14a14d18679b82ec3ff1beafe61d89c070084da59ef3faee210:0

value
53331082
script pubkey
OP_0 OP_PUSHBYTES_20 ec0e22febf2d21f569db45c512042f431a64c7d6
address
bc1qas8z9l4l95sl26wmghz3ypp0gvdxf37kje9cfh
transaction
50eea889c32aa14a14d18679b82ec3ff1beafe61d89c070084da59ef3faee210
spent
true